Site Manager (Electrical)

Aberdeen & Central Belt, Scotland

Permanent

Our client, a leader in the renewable energy industry, is currently seeking a skilled Site Manager with a background in electrical work to join their dynamic team. This is an exciting opportunity to oversee and manage various on-site activities, ensuring the successful completion of renewable projects.

As a Site Manager for our Client, you will be responsible for overseeing all on-site activities related to projects. From managing site workers and subcontractors to ensuring compliance with quality and safety standards, this role plays a crucial part in the successful delivery of projects.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ee all site activities including groundwork, installation, and commissioning of solar PV systems.
  • Manage and coordinate site teams, subcontractors, and suppliers to maintain smooth operations.
  • Ensure all work meets technical drawings, manufacturer specifications, and industry regulations.
  • Drive site safety standards, conduct regular inspections, and enforce compliance with HSE protocols.
  • Monitor budgets, materials, and equipment to ensure projects stay on track and within cost.
  • Collaborate with clients, engineers, and internal teams, providing clear progress updates and documentation.
  • Lead testing, performance verification, and client handover at project completion.

Required Skills:

  • Previous experience in a similar role within the renewable energy or electrical industry
  • Strong understanding of solar panel installations, electrical connections, and industry standards
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to liaise with clients, engineers, and team members
  • Problem-solving skills to address on-site challenges and conflicts
  • Knowledge of safety protocols, environmental regulations, and budget management

Desirable Skills & Experience:

  • Certifications in project management or relevant electrical qualifications
  • Experience with commissioning solar projects and performance testing
  • Familiarity with software tools for project scheduling and management
